dbus-daemon
时间: 2023-08-03 16:07:43 浏览: 95
DBus-daemon是D-Bus消息总线系统的守护进程,它运行在Linux和类Unix操作系统上,并为DBus应用程序提供系统级别的消息传递服务。DBus-daemon通过对DBus总线进行管理,使得不同的应用程序能够相互通信和协作。DBus-daemon还提供了一些安全机制,防止未经授权的应用程序访问DBus总线。DBus-daemon是DBus的核心组件之一,被广泛应用于Linux和Unix操作系统中,如Ubuntu、Fedora、Debian等等。
相关问题
linux下 /usr/bin/dbus-daemon --syslog-only --fork -print-pid -6 print-address 8 是什么意思
### 回答1:
这是在 Linux 系统中运行 dbus-daemon 的命令。其中:
- "--syslog-only" 表示将日志输出到 syslog 而不是显示在终端上。
- "--fork" 表示在后台运行 dbus-daemon 进程。
- "-print-pid" 表示在运行 dbus-daemon 时显示进程号。
- "-6" 表示使用 IPv6 协议。
- "print-address" 表示显示 dbus-daemon 的地址。
- "8" 表示监听的端口号是 8。
简单来说就是运行dbus-daemon进程,将日志输出到syslog,在后台运行,显示进程号,使用IPv6协议,显示dbus-daemon的地址,监听端口号为8.
### 回答2:
在Linux系统中,"/usr/bin/dbus-daemon --syslog-only --fork -print-pid -6 print-address 8" 是一个用于启动DBus守护进程的命令。DBus是一种用于进程间通信的机制,可以在不同的应用程序之间传递消息和调用方法。
具体地,该命令的参数含义如下:
- "--syslog-only" 表示DBus守护进程将仅将日志输出到系统日志,而不是标准输出设备。
- "--fork" 表示DBus守护进程将在后台运行。
- "-print-pid" 表示DBus守护进程在启动时将输出其进程ID。
- "-6" 表示DBus守护进程将使用IPv6协议进行通信。
- "print-address 8" 是DBus守护进程的配置选项,指示该进程在启动时将输出其监听地址,并将使用编号为8的总线。
总之,该命令的作用是启动DBus守护进程,并按照指定的参数进行配置和运行。DBus守护进程将负责处理进程间通信,并提供一种可靠和安全的机制来实现不同应用程序之间的消息传递。
dbus-common
D-Bus是一个跨计算机应用程序的消息总线系统,它允许不同的应用程序在不同的计算机之间通信和协作,以实现更好的系统集成。DBus-common是DBus的常规工具和库的集合,包括DBus-daemon、DBus-send、DBus-monitor、DBus-launch等等,这些工具和库可以帮助开发人员构建和测试DBus应用程序。DBus-common还包括一些开发文档和示例,以帮助开发人员更好地理解和使用DBus。DBus-common是由freedesktop.org管理的开源项目,被广泛应用于Linux和Unix操作系统中,如Ubuntu、Fedora、Debian等等。